Photographic fascimiles of letters allegedly from Charles Stewart Parnell to Patrick Egan in 1882, used by the handwriting expert for his report for the defence in the Parnell Commission,
[1888].

Notes: | Each of these photographic facsimiles includes a reproduction of a government stamp "S C / 1888" and are numbered 4 to 10 in manuscript with the name "O'Shea" indicating that it was through Captain William O'Shea that these letters were submitted to the Special Commission. O'Shea vouched for the authentication of the signatures. Physical description: 7 items. more |
